The National Security Sector at Leidos is seeking a highly motivated DNA Technical Expert to manage programs within its Homeland and Force Protection Business Area. The candidate will support our Agile DevSecOps contract and be responsible for understanding customer needs to create new business and efficiently and effectively executing technical programs. The ideal candidate will possess superior analytical and problem-solving skills, operate independently with limited supervision and feedback, be a strong team player, and can establish solid working relationships with technical staff and peers within the division, as well as our external Government customers.

Primary Responsibilities:

  • Organizes, directs, and manages contract operation support functions, involving multiple, complex and inter-related project tasks.

  • Maintain the Concept of Operations by reflecting changes in operations as software changes are made to the CODIS application.

  • Provide support to the development teams for implementing and testing possible future Popstats calculation enhancements.

  • Identify advances in technology and genetic analysis that could benefit the CODIS program.

  • Determine if data generated using the Dataset Generator utility is a scientifically accurate representation of specimens that typically exist in a CODIS production database.

Clearance Required:

  • Current Secret.

Required Experience, Skills, and Education:

  • 12+ years of experience specifically in the field of human population statistics (Statistics SME)

  • Understanding of the calculations used in Forensic Single Sample, Mixture, Semi-continuous (SC) Mixture, Kinship, Parentage, Partial Match, and Match Estimation.

  • SME should have at least 2 years of experience working with CODIS in a laboratory environment (CODIS SME).

  • At least 5 years of experience working with CODIS.

  • Understanding of CODIS searches: Auto-Searcher, Searcher, Batch Searcher, Rapid Search Requests, and Interoperability Services Specimen Search.

  • Knowledgeable of how CODIS is used within a laboratory environment to enter specimen data and find matches with other CODIS laboratories.

  • Provide support to the development teams for implementing and testing possible future Popstats calculation enhancements.

  • Validate testing approaches and the accuracy of system documentation (ConOps, functional specifications, and other technical documentation).

  • Familiar with loci homozygosity rates and allele frequencies.

  • Bachelor’s degree or higher degree related field preferred (additional experience, education and training may be considered in lieu of degree).

Preferred Experience, Skills, and Education:

  • Advance degree in Biometrics or equivalent IT related field preferred

  • Top Secret Clearance.

  • Experience in communications, cloud migration, and DevSecOps; hardware/software fabrication; Cloud, platform system integration; and/or test and evaluation.
